Kadri Veseli

The Special Court has rejected the request for release from custody of the former chairman of PDK, Kadri Veseli.

The request was made by Vesel's lawyer, Ben Emmerson, who had requested that his client be temporarily released from custody.

In the response returned by the "Special", it is stated that the request can not be accepted on the grounds that there is "a constant risk of escape that will only increase if Veseli finds out all the evidence against him."

Former KLA leaders Hashim Thaçi, Kadri Veseli, Jakup Krasniqi, Rexhep Selimi together with 3 former KLA fighters are charged with war crimes and crimes against humanity

Recall that 10 former KLA fighters are charged with persecution, imprisonment, arbitrary detention, other inhumane acts, cruel treatment, torture, murder as a crime against humanity, illegal murder as a war crime, disappearance with force of persons, in the period between April 1998- August 1991.
